Developmental Transmission Through Relationship

Definition

A model proposing that human development beyond the information level requires transmission through relationship from one who has developed to one who is developing. This includes transmission of values, character, integrity, and way-of-being that cannot be extracted into rules or teachings but only absorbed through proximity and modeling.
